Most helpful review Charlie and the Chocolate Factory

  • You can eat the grass?

    Rated - 5.0 stars  
    By JediSi (301 reviews) from Kent , 29 Sep 2007

    [Highly rated reviewer]

    'Charlie and the Chocolate Factory' is based on the Roald Dahl novel of the same name. Dahl wrote many so called children's books but the stories were full of society critic. Tim Burton has followed Dahl very accurately and he has saved the critical voice of Dahl. With a lot of black humor and jokes makes the movie more than enjoyable experience.

    Johnny Depp lights up every single movie he has been in, and Tim Burton always has a way of giving you a 'dark fairytale' vibe, which means it's the perfect combo...as we've have seen before in classics like Edward Scissorhands.

    The inside of the factory is perfectly magical, and because of this, the movie had its final touch of greatness. Awesome musical score from Danny Elfman adds to this work perfection.

    Wonderful direction, brilliant cast, make Charlie and the Chocolate Factory a tour through the factory that you cannot miss. It doesn't take a golden ticket to go see this film, so I recommend seeing it to anyone who hasn't already.

  • Bronze Ticket.. maybe....

    Rated - 1.5 stars  
    By DMarko (4 reviews) from Heysham , 20 May 2012

    THIS REVIEW CONTAINS SPOILERS Show review anywayHide

    If you are a huge FAN of the original film, then i'm sure you will appreciate a modern version to add to your collection- That is so long as you don't miss the songs, the original Oompa Loompa's and are in no way freaked out by Johnny Depp's voice in this one. (he is trying to sound like Gene Wilder ... i think)

    If you haven't ever seen Charlie and the Chocolate Factory, then send this disc back, or cancel your rental order and get the 1971 Gene Wilder version FIRST, its genius in comparison and the songs are infectious.

    It looks good on the whole, but its massively OTT(and YES i have seen the original many times).To clear that up I would say that the original was OTT enough to feel magical, whereas this just feels fake and overexposed from the minute the factory is opened (like a CGI experiment). The Oompa Loompa's are creepy guitar playing chocoholics, Willy Wonka looks like he has been in Arkham Asylum for a few years and the child castings (apart from Charlie) and songs are completely forgettable.

    On the up side, the family scenes are much more moving, and Charlie feels more believable, i really thought the opening scenes were great. The factory itself and Willy Wonka himself were massive disappointments.

  • I love Tim Burton but stick with the original

    Rated - 2.0 stars  
    By Bassman71 (630 reviews) from Didsbury, England , 29 Feb 2012
    Tim Burton’s remake of the 1971 classic with Johnny Depp taking over the Gene Wilder role of Willy Wonka.

    I must admit I was expecting a lot more from this and especially as I’m a fan of Burton’s work but it never seems to find its feet.

    It’s inevitable that comparisons will be made to the original and as I much as I like Johnny Depp he just doesn’t have enough screen presence as Wilder did.

    I think if Burton had gone for his usual trademark dark and weird the film as a whole would have been more entertaining but instead it’s a very average and forgettable spectacle.

    Danny Elfman does the music which isn’t bad but the songs again are nowhere as good as the 1971 version.
